Control of Temperature

A quality wine fridge is crucial to ensure that your wine is kept at a steady temperature. This will slow down the process of aging and will ensure that your wines are at their best. The ideal temperature to store wine is between 45 and 65 degrees Fahrenheit. This is the ideal range to store both red and white wine. Some models also come with a dual zone temperature control feature that allows you to choose different temperatures for each part of the refrigerator.

Another crucial aspect of the mini wine fridge is its humidity level. A low level of humidity can dry out the cork and affect the wine's flavor and texture. To avoid this, you should keep your check here wine at a humidity level between 50 and 70 percent. Store your wine horizontally to stop air from getting in and degrading the wine.

There are two types of wine fridges available on the market: dual-zone and single-temperature. Dual-zone wine refrigerators have two distinct zones that can be set to different temperatures. This is ideal for those who love white and red wines. Single-temperature wine fridges on the other hand are equipped with a fixed temperature that is suitable for all types of wines.
